Summary
The Taiheiyo cement Composite Design System (TCDS®) was developed to efficiently meet the user’s needs. The addition of fundamental data for composite cement, that uses blast furnace slag, fly ash, and limestone powder, will further increase the prediction accuracy of the design. Similarly, other kinds of admixtures will be included for composite cement application, such as natural pozzolan.
Future plans
Aside from the TCDS®, the Taiheiyo Cement Quality Predictive System (TQPS®) is programmed to predict physical properties of Portland cements. We are developing a software that predicts the properties of concrete using composite cement, similar to the Durability Prediction System.
The overall aim is to achieve a simulation system for the process of burning clinkers, followed by the design of composite cement, and finally the design of concrete quality. All in order to provide the optimal quality cement to its users and consumers.
